|
|
|
@ -28,6 +28,10 @@ if [ -n "${TMUX}" ]; then |
|
|
|
PROMPT_COMMAND="_tmux_update_environment" |
|
|
|
PROMPT_COMMAND="_tmux_update_environment" |
|
|
|
fi |
|
|
|
fi |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
# gpg-agent: started on demand, but must set GPG_TTY |
|
|
|
|
|
|
|
GPG_TTY=$(tty) |
|
|
|
|
|
|
|
export GPG_TTY |
|
|
|
|
|
|
|
|
|
|
|
# Start tmux by default |
|
|
|
# Start tmux by default |
|
|
|
if command -v tmux &> /dev/null && [ -z "$TMUX" ]; then |
|
|
|
if command -v tmux &> /dev/null && [ -z "$TMUX" ]; then |
|
|
|
if grep "default: " <(tmux list-sessions 2> /dev/null) > /dev/null; then |
|
|
|
if grep "default: " <(tmux list-sessions 2> /dev/null) > /dev/null; then |
|
|
|
|